We Had to Remove This Post

It's really hard to put my thoughts about this this novella into a coherent form. Especially without spoilers.

Overall I liked it. It is thought provoking in ways I wasn't expecting.

If anything holds me back from an absolute recommendation is the prose. That it is a translation shows. 73 words in a sentence just doesn't work the same way in English as it does in some languages.
